They urged that this law clearly recognise the right to access to information as a fundamental right protected by the freedom of information provision of the Spanish Constitution (Article 20) and as recognized by the European Court of Human Rights and the Inter-American Court of Human Rights.<\/p>\n<p>The meeting lasted two hours and included a constructive and interesting exchange of views. The Department of Legal Coordination is considering that the draft should meet the standards set in the \u201c9 Principles\u201d developed by the Coalici\u00f3n Pro Acceso.<\/p>\n<p>  <!--more-->  <\/p>\n<p>There are, however, still many outstanding issues, such as the structure of the independent authority, including the possibility of combining this authority with the Ombudsman\u2019s Office or the Data Protection Agency. The most important issue for the Coalici\u00f3n Pro Acceso is that this body has the necessary resources and powers to protect the right to access to information. In other European countries, the combination of protection of personal data with the protection of access to information works well to ensure a good balance between both fundamental rights.<\/p>\n<p>Both parties are in agreement that public administrative bodies should disclose information proactively even before requests are submitted. They believe that a significant effort will be needed for the public administration to adapt to the right of access to information.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cSpain is one of the last European countries to adopt an access to information law so it has the opportunity to draft a progressive law which reflects the highest standards.
